Transaction 25739829c345eef2057469f8b3e08deef49ab6f65c8a6318c4a243bf0a2f68d8
1 Input
1 Output
-
25739829c345eef2057469f8b3e08deef49ab6f65c8a6318c4a243bf0a2f68d8:0
- value
- 551314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bb0112249d3a81cbb0603cec6a91cc12e5b0856 OP_EQUAL
- address
- 3QdpT39nnUjpcud1MZgkRVFWpKexqsUcVB